Setting the Language for the Photo Index Sheet
You can select a language for the Photo Index Sheet that is used to print photos saved on a memory
card.
Note
Depending on the country or region of purchase, the Language Selection Sheet will be printed
when you press the
Photo Index Sheet
button if the language for the Photo Index Sheet has not
been selected. In this case, follow the procedures from step 4 onwards.
You need to prepare: A4 or Letter-sized plain paper and a memory card on which
photos are saved
1.
Make sure that the power is turned on, and load two or more sheets of A4 or Letter-
sized plain paper in the Rear Tray.
2.
Open the Paper Output Tray gently, and open the Output Tray Extension.
3.
Print the Language Selection Sheet.
(1)
Make sure that the memory card is inserted.
Note
Do not remove the memory card until all the operations are completed.
(2)
Press the
(Maintenance) button repeatedly until
h
appears.
(3)
Press the
Black
or
Color
button.
The Language Selection Sheet will be printed.
4.
Fill in the circle of a desired language used to print the Photo Index Sheet.
Fill in the circle with a dark pencil or a black ink pen to select a language.
